# Shopify Product Returns Report

## Use Case

Using this report, you can assess return trends at article level, allowing for better inventory management, product quality improvements, and return policy optimization.

The second section of Shopify returns analytics is the <code class="expression">space.vars.Report\_RIShopifyProductReturns</code> report, which focuses on article-level return KPIs, offering a detailed view of product return trends.

At the top of the report, you can apply filters to display information by product to monitor the performance of specific items and identify if there are common compensation methods with certain products.

<figure><img src="https://1156682959-files.gitbook.io/~/files/v0/b/gitbook-x-prod.appspot.com/o/spaces%2F-LPf1Lv1YUuLYva6LrXQ%2Fuploads%2F80yTns7tZk4SVOwK2SWY%2FShopifyProductReturnsFilters.png?alt=media&#x26;token=ea158494-a327-4233-975f-9611903539ce" alt="Available filters such as product and category for Shopify Product Returns report"><figcaption></figcaption></figure>

The report consists of a table providing a matrix style overview of product return performance, including the return rate and the number of returns via different compensation methods for a product, with the date the report was last refreshed shown above it.

More detailed insights can be found in the <code class="expression">space.vars.Report\_RIShopifyProductReturns</code> report by selecting the dimensions above the table to focus on specific item details.
